Nanotechnology for excipients (or “nanotech”) is the use of matter on an atomic, molecular, and supramolecular scale for industrial purposes. The National Nanotechnology Initiative defined nanotechnology as the manipulation of matter with at least one dimension sized from 1 to 100 nanometers.
